查看文件编码格式如下,将文件格式修改为UTF-8

 >file demo.txt>demo.txt: ISO-8859 text
>vim demo.txt
>:set fileencoding#显示fileencoding=latin1

设置编码格式为utf-8

 :setlocal buftype=:set fileencoding=utf-8:wq!

在查看编码格式:

>:set fileencoding#显示fileencoding=utf-8

2.iconv转换编码
iconv -c -f latin1 -t utf-8 demo.txt > demo.txt
3.修改编码格式一般是为了解决中文乱码的问题。可以修改终端编码与文件编码一致。
查看编码格式:

修改:
export LC_ALL=en_US.iso88591
当然修改终端编码还可以在 /etc/profile 设置。
如有错误,还望不吝指正,谢谢。

Linux修改文件编码格式的三种方式相关推荐

  1. linux两种方式改变文件权限,Linux更改文件权限的两种方式

    今天小编要跟大家分享一篇关于Linux更改文件权限的方式,喜欢Linux的小伙伴来看一看吧. 我们知道·Linux系统最主要的特点之一就是--Linux系统是多用户.多任务的操作系统. 何为多用户?就 ...

  2. 【查看linux中所有用户的三种方式】

    查看linux中所有用户的三种方式学习目标: 提示:通过使用 /etc/passwd 文件,getent 命令,compgen 命令这三种方法查看系统中用户的信息 用户信息存放位置: 提示:Linux ...

  3. 总结Linux修改主机名的四种方式

    总结Linux修改主机名的四种方式 看网上很多文章,有些比较简洁,但是有些很繁琐,不多说,参考各路大神的文章,以下是本人对这几种方式进行简要介绍,如有不足之处,还望各位大佬指点迷津. 方式一(个人推荐 ...

  4. sass文件编译的三种方式【舒】

    [舒:]sass文件编译的三种方式 方式一: 1.webstorm打开evtGulp项目或者mcake-activity项目 2.中,开启gulp->default/develop,启动watc ...

  5. Linux清空文件内容的三种方法

    Linux清空文件内容的三种方法 测试文件:a.txt 第一种: $> a.txt 第二种: $echo "" > a.txt 第三种: $cat /dev/null ...

  6. 用python打开文件夹的三种方式

    用python打开文件夹的三种方式 一.利用explorer.exe import os# 利用explorer.exe执行 start_directory = r'C:\代码\软件包' os.sys ...

  7. Linux清理文件内容的四种方式

    原文:https://www.cnblogs.com/zqifa/p/linux-vim-4.html linux系统中清空文件内容的三种方法1.使用vi/vim命令打开文件后,输入"%d& ...

  8. MySQL数据库修改数据库名的三种方式

    在Innodb数据库引擎下修改数据库名的方式与MyISAM引擎下修改数据库的方式完全不一样,如果是MyISAM可以直接去数据库目录中mv就可以,Innodb如果用同样的方法修改会提示相关表不存在. 第 ...

  9. linux 设置开机启动项三种方式

    有时候我们需要Linux系统在开机的时候自动加载某些脚本或系统服务. 在解问题之前先来看看Linux的启动流程 Linux的启动流程 主要顺序就是: 1. 加载内核 2. 启动初始化进程 3. 确定运 ...

  10. 获取class文件对象的三种方式

    package cn.learn_01;/** 反射:就是通过class文件对象,去使用该文件中的成员变量,构造方法,成员方法.* * Person p = new Person();* p.使用* ...

最新文章

  1. 如何理解Transformer论文中的positional encoding,和三角函数有什么关系?
  2. swift 1.2 升级
  3. Security+jwt+验证码实现验证和授权
  4. python 日期_python日期操作
  5. mysql len hex asc_线上频出MySQL死锁问题!分享一下自己教科书般的排查和分析过程!...
  6. Sentinel(二)之Quick Start
  7. 反射 数据类型_C#扫盲篇(一):反射机制情真意切的说
  8. 微信小程序开发学习笔记007--微信小程序项目01
  9. Redis 2.8.18 安装报错 error: jemalloc/jemalloc.h: No such file or directory解决方法
  10. 3分钟理解完java中的回调函数
  11. 美国通货膨胀持续引发市场关注,国际黄金价格还有上涨机会吗?
  12. 取自开源,分享于开源 —— 利用CVE-2017-8890漏洞ROOT天猫魔屏A1
  13. 人工智能-八数码问题-启发式搜索
  14. 如何用云计算提高员工工作效率
  15. Enhancer云开发平台发布了!打开浏览器写 SQL 做配置就能一站完成系统开发
  16. 解决Ubuntu 安装时Unable to fetch some archives connection failed [ip: 91.189.91.39 80]
  17. UMI绝对定量转录组+代谢组联合研究β-葡萄糖苷酶抑制剂在草菇采后贮藏中的应用前景
  18. 项管(十六)——文档管理、配置管理、知识管理、变更管理
  19. TDW计算引擎解析——Scheduler
  20. [AGC001E]BBQ Hard

热门文章

  1. 小米蓝牙键盘怎么连接_不是吐槽,是推荐!买了个小米旗下的蓝牙双模键盘。。。...
  2. SD皇冠毛绒布料材质制作视频教程 中文字幕
  3. QT获取HDMI视频采集数据
  4. STM32F0单片机快速入门八: Coolie DMA
  5. 多粒度网络(MGN)的结构设计与技术实现
  6. 【STC单片机】通过ADC外部输入调节PWM占空比输出并串口打印当前脉冲值
  7. 火狐浏览器丢失书签,恢复无法处理备份文件的解决方案
  8. android布局跑马灯,Android自定义跑马灯效果(适合任意布局)
  9. 5G网络架构 — 接入网/传输网/核心网
  10. 触发器(SR锁存器、SR触发器、JK触发器、D触发器、T触发器)